Made famous beginning in the late 1930s when Hollywood director John Ford began filming his westerns here, Monument Valley became the front door to the great American West, if only as a myth, for millions of audiences. You may hike the short trail from the boat dock or embark on the two-day hike along the Navajo Mountain Trail after securing a permit from Navajo Nation Parks and Recreation.
